This is an extremely rare 1921 Silver Gillette Richwood Razor kit with absolutly no plate loss.
The Richwood set consists of a dovetail mahogany box/case with a wood lining, with a SILVER plated
razor and a SILVER blade box. The case has some wear, which is a small amount of lacqur loss but
not much considering its age. The dark wooden interior shows a small bit of wear to the razor's bed
which is just a bit of wear to the lacquer. The handle is in great shape with no cracks.

The case is a dark mahogany dove tail case and is in very good+ used condition. The hinges and
latch function perfectly, opening and closing properly. A Rare Gillette Richwood Razor complete
in its original mahogany box with razor blade holder and razor. This vintage shaving kit will be
a nice addition to your collection or for daily use.

It has a serial #231209A stamped on the comb piece and 'PAT. JAN. 13 1920' stamped at the base
of the handle. The razor is in MINT condition, no plate loss, brassing or rust.
Rare original Richwood box with solid dove-tail construction and push-button latch. Hinges and
latch work as they should (box closes evenly with a snap). The blade safe shows no wear to the
